Subject: Handover — Quillform formula sandbox

Hi Darya,

Quick handover on the Quillform sandbox work. User-supplied formulas now execute in the Kestrelbox interpreter with a 200 ms budget and no filesystem access. The allowlist of functions lives in the sandbox_policy table; edits there take effect on the next worker restart. Denied evaluations are logged with the formula hash only, never the raw text. The policy loader connects to the config database with the string below.

primary connection of tajeg-tajop = postgresql://julax_svc:DI@db-e7f3.kelvidyn.corp:5432/rusdor

Build provenance — SquatGuard scanner. Every release artifact is built in the sealed Fernhollow pipeline. No manual uploads, ever. Provenance attestation is generated at package time and stored alongside the signature manifest. On-call: if a customer-reported binary lacks an attestation, treat it as untrusted and pull it from the mirror. Verify the hash chain before re-signing anything. Each verified build carries a short provenance token; the current release's token appears below.

pipeline stamp: htk9_ce63042d9

## Changelog — Banner v2.3.0: Changed defaults

For the release manager: this release changes the default behavior of the Consentio banner rollout. Opt-in is now the default for all analytics categories, the dismissal timeout has been shortened, and the banner renders before any tracking scripts load. Regional variants inherit these defaults unless explicitly overridden. The new default configuration values shipping with this release are listed below.

service settings:
novath:
  pin: 1396
  tenant: pelys
  seal: seal_ccc035e1
  metrics_host: metrics.novath.qorvelworks.test
  standby_team: fraeth
  escalation: drueth-zorok
  nonce: 61d508

**Key Ceremony Checklist — Item 7 (Cronfall Migration)**

Context for eng sync: legacy cron jobs are moving to the Weftline workflow engine. Before decommissioning the Pinehollow cron host, sign the migration manifest with the ceremony key. Two witnesses required. Verify job parity report first; no unsigned manifests ship. Retrieval of the ceremony key from cold storage requires the recovery passphrase recorded below.

unlock words, tagaf-hahif: ralwyn-lammir-rusax-sormir